Key Facts

  • Massachusetts state income tax on $485,000 is $24,250 — 5.00% of gross income.
  • Combined with federal taxes and FICA, total tax burden is $178,813 (36.87%).
  • Take-home pay is $306,187, or $25,516 per month.
